Does anyone know if there's an RFE for opening an RPG source (or really any source) with trailing spaces trimmed? I just hit the "one time too many" of copying over trailing spaces into source and when I hit the "end" key to go to the end of the code, it took me way beyond column 80. Yes, I can do the trim thing. I just don't want to have to do that on every source I open. Plus it marks the source as modified.

If there isn't an RFE, I'll open one. This has bugged me for a very long time.
